Gateway to Prince Edward Island, this charming town welcomes visitors crossing the Confederation Bridge with its iconic lighthouse and waterfront views. Explore the Marine Rail Park where ferries once docked, then visit nearby Cavendish for the famous Anne of Green Gables attractions.

The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 63°F, while the coldest months are February and January with an average of 25°F. Average annual precipitation for Borden-Carleton is 48 inches.
